Idaho Code § 7-1051.34

Procedure to register child-support order of another state for modification

I.C., § 7-1043, as added by 1994, ch. 207, § 2, p. 639; am. and redesig. 1997, ch. 198, § 27, p. 556; am. and redesig. 2006, ch. 252, § 51, p. 764; am. 2015 (1st E.S.), ch. 1, §…

A party or support enforcement agency seeking to modify, or to modify and enforce, a child-support order issued in another state shall register that order in this state in the same manner provided in sections 7-1043 through 7-1050, Idaho Code, if the order has not been registered. A petition for modification may be filed at the same time as a request for registration, or later. The pleading must specify the grounds for modification.
